Output 85106cd6073a9b34c05829bd550806670a3ae81fa2c6c281922995e86d2a7bd9:0

value
1854379554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 445d8ad488af95c32512b310f23fe8ef85f7a0a3 OP_EQUALVERIFY OP_CHECKSIG
address
17EV1UiK9VGymUXZESTnmj19ZJjDvFRmqW
transaction
85106cd6073a9b34c05829bd550806670a3ae81fa2c6c281922995e86d2a7bd9
spent
true